Acting as the threat in Chapter III (The School), Good Boy is a twist on the typical haunted pet trope. It is a grey, eyeless dog-like creature with razor-sharp teeth. In the lore, Good Boy was once the pet of the burglar, who was abused and neglected, transforming it into a monster. Unlike the other ghosts, Good Boy is not easily evaded by hiding; players must use a unique item——thrown on the ground to distract him for a few seconds.
